    is the goblin chitin for priest any good ?

    u need less int for them and i guess the resist is nice but are they good for any built ?[/b]
    yeah they are good, especially for Chitin BP. Those stats are good. Well the pads IMO is better than the pauldron. But besides those 2 pieces, the rest are junk. Why its so good is because it gives good resists (32 if you have pads + pauld) and it requires less points into INT, so you can put into HP. The bonuses HP and STR bonuses are still good, even though not as good as +8 chitin... but the resists make up for that :P
